AROS-v0/rom/hyperlayers/mmakefile.src

70 lines
1.4 KiB
Plaintext

# $Id$
include $(SRCDIR)/config/aros.cfg
FILES := basicfuncs createlayertaglist movelayerz
FUNCS := \
beginupdate \
behindlayer \
changelayershape \
changelayervisibility \
collectpixelslayer \
createbehindhooklayer \
createbehindlayer \
createbehindlayertaglist \
createupfronthooklayer \
createupfrontlayer \
createupfrontlayertaglist \
deletelayer \
disposelayerinfo \
dohookcliprects \
endupdate \
fattenlayerinfo \
getfirstfamilymember \
initlayers \
installclipregion \
installlayerhook \
installlayerinfohook \
islayerhiddenbysibling \
islayervisible \
locklayer \
locklayerinfo \
locklayers \
movelayer \
movelayerinfrontof \
movesizelayer \
newlayerinfo \
scalelayer \
scrolllayer \
sizelayer \
sortlayercr \
swapbitsrastportcliprect \
thinlayerinfo \
unlocklayer \
unlocklayerinfo \
unlocklayers \
upfrontlayer \
whichlayer
#MM kernel-layers : kernel-layers-$(ARCH)-$(CPU)
#MM kernel-layers-kobj : kernel-layers-$(ARCH)-$(CPU)
#MM kernel-layers-includes : \
#MM kernel-exec-includes \
#MM kernel-graphics-includes \
#MM kernel-utility-includes \
#MM includes-copy
#MM- core-linklibs: linklibs-layers
USER_CPPFLAGS := \
-DUSE_EXEC_DEBUG \
-D__UTILITY_NOLIBBASE__ \
-D__GRAPHICS_NOLIBBASE__
USER_LDFLAGS := -static
%build_module mmake=kernel-layers \
modname=layers modtype=library \
files="layers_init $(FUNCS) $(FILES)" usesdks="config"